Join us for the 35th annual Heart & Sole Walk for Animals – Sunday, October 20th at Fort Adams State Park! Many of you have met Homer, The Hive’s mascot that has been a happy coworking member here since he was 10 weeks old? We found him at The Potter League, a 95 year old animal welfare nonprofit on Aquidneck Island that also runs the state’s only spay/neuter clinic in Warwick, as well as Pets In Need (a full scale veterinary clinic in East Providence that offers affordable pet care for anyone utilizing public assistance). The Potter League also stocks many pet food pantries across the state, including one at our North Kingstown Food Pantry and has a Community Navigator (social worker) on staff that interacts with many statewide agencies supporting the humans attached to the pets we serve.
